How they compare

China, mainland currently reports 691,170 kt against 41,330 kt in Venezuela (Bolivarian Republic of), a difference of 649,840 kt.

That makes China, mainland's figure about 16.7 times Venezuela (Bolivarian Republic of)'s.

Across all 63 years both countries report, China, mainland has been ahead every year.

China, mainland ranks 4th and Venezuela (Bolivarian Republic of) ranks 7th of 226 countries.

China, mainland has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ade China, mainland Venezuela (Bolivarian Republic of) Difference Ahead
1960s 347,441 kt 16,965 kt 330,476 kt China, mainland
1970s 444,459 kt 21,661 kt 422,798 kt China, mainland
1980s 523,122 kt 28,472 kt 494,651 kt China, mainland
1990s 650,584 kt 34,336 kt 616,248 kt China, mainland
2000s 686,868 kt 40,152 kt 646,716 kt China, mainland
2010s 689,720 kt 40,169 kt 649,552 kt China, mainland
2020s 684,844 kt 41,062 kt 643,782 kt China, mainland

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
